Cats, for Instance Favour, the Actual Evening Far Better Compared to Day Time.

They may be much more energetic in the evening. Therefore to reduce energy throughout the day, play together with your cat before heading to your work. It'll snooze for a longer time throughout the day, and your cat behaviour will improve because it received a bit of your attention previously.

It Takes Time to Train a Cat, but They Usually Learn Our Ways

We all can feel annoyed with our house pets, every once in a while. If they are engaging in things and we don't approve. The ultimate question is, can you train your cat? Yes! A cat can always learn. It is better to train a cat than to discipline a cat. Punishing can cause further cat behaviour problems, but training is the key to fixing your cat's behaviour.
